en Where I caught that big bass we could clearly see other bass cruising the shallows. That tells me that they are moving up and getting ready to bed. In fact, we saw several beds in about 5 feet of water. Everybody is getting excited about the spawn. We'll probably have bass on the beds by this weekend. But the real push of spawning bass won't come for another 10 days or so.

en I have mixed emotions about fishing for spawning bass and I respect other's opinions who feel they shouldn't be fished. But a lot of guys don't understand the time and aggravation that goes into fishing these big bass. The stars really have to be aligned. Conditions have to be perfect. Guys like Mike Long and John Kerr (two other local big bass hunters) know that. It's hard enough just to find a bass that big, much less get it to bite or catch it. Only the people who have caught and fought these big bass know that.

en In the early '70's, Keith and I were in a band called Canyon that played around the area, in places like the Jolly Ox. We met Randy, and one Monday night we got together, sang a few songs and I think we all knew we had something special brewing. By Wednesday, I had borrowed a bass guitar and we had a gig at this new club in Chattanooga, Yesterday's, and our first show was Thursday night. We knew 20 songs. When I think back on it, I'm still amazed.
